works great, batterly last 2 days!! only thing i can complain about is if you have straight talk you cant connect your phone with an esims , but bluetooth reaches super far, so its still worth it!
[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] I love this watch, I've owned it for 9 months now and just like my previous watches its holding up perfectly (I always get the new ones although my old ones work great still) the screen on these is really good for scratch resistance I am a clumsy person and flail my arms a lot but its still not been scratched at all on the screen (couple scuffs on the rim). The battery holds about days charge with the monitors running, doesn't super hold charge if you use it for too long on 4G alone but still pretty good for trips out where you don't need your phone.
i love all the features of this watch. i love the way it looks on my wrist. it seems to be holding up nicely when woen daily in a manufacturing setting. with the battery saver on, the battery can last almost 4 days. otherwise you need to charge it every day. you can anwer calls, text, control your music, track anything etc.

Purchased the 44mm Lte watches for my kids, the battery life is terrible when mobile data is turned on, at best we get 8-10 hours. When reviewing battery usage it does not show system usage as there is a large gap between actual usage and apps listed usage. We have everything turned off including Bluetooth and wifi and the always on display and still struggle to get through the day. I regret purchasing the two watches and hope that Samsung fixes the battery issues.
